Definitions from Wikipedia (January 1)
▸ noun: the first day of the year in the Gregorian Calendar; 364 days remain until the end of the year (365 in leap years).
▸ noun: December 31 - Eastern Orthodox liturgical calendar - January 2
▸ noun: a 1984 Indian Tamil-language film written and directed by Manivannan.
▸ noun: (New Year's Day) the first day of the year in the Gregorian calendar.
